Uses of Interface
org.jboss.dna.graph.property.Reference

Packages that use Reference
org.jboss.dna.connector.store.jpa.util The classes that define the utility JPA entities that are not part of any storage model. 
org.jboss.dna.graph The JBoss DNA Graph API defines the types that allow you to work with content organized as a graph. 
org.jboss.dna.graph.property Nodes in a graph contain properties, and this package defines the interfaces, classes and exceptions for representing and working with properties and their values. 
org.jboss.dna.graph.property.basic A set of basic implementations of the various interfaces defined in org.jboss.dna.graph.property
 

Uses of Reference in org.jboss.dna.connector.store.jpa.util
 

Methods in org.jboss.dna.connector.store.jpa.util with parameters of type Reference
 void Serializer.ReferenceValues.read(Reference reference)
           
 void Serializer.ReferenceValues.remove(Reference reference)
           
 void Serializer.ReferenceValues.write(Reference reference)
           
 

Uses of Reference in org.jboss.dna.graph
 

Methods in org.jboss.dna.graph with parameters of type Reference
 Node Graph.resolve(Reference reference)
          Request to read the node given by the supplied reference value.
 Next Graph.SetValuesTo.to(Reference value)
          Set the property value to the given Reference.
 

Uses of Reference in org.jboss.dna.graph.property
 

Fields in org.jboss.dna.graph.property with type parameters of type Reference
static Comparator<Reference> ValueComparators.REFERENCE_COMPARATOR
          A comparator of reference values.
 

Methods in org.jboss.dna.graph.property that return types with arguments of type Reference
 Map<Location,List<Reference>> ReferentialIntegrityException.getInvalidReferences()
           
 ValueFactory<Reference> ValueFactories.getReferenceFactory()
          Get the value factory for reference properties.
 

Methods in org.jboss.dna.graph.property with parameters of type Reference
 T ValueFactory.create(Reference value)
          Create a value from a reference.
 T[] ValueFactory.create(Reference[] values)
          Create an array of values from an array of references.
 

Constructors in org.jboss.dna.graph.property with parameters of type Reference
ReferentialIntegrityException(Location location, Reference... invalidReferences)
           
 

Constructor parameters in org.jboss.dna.graph.property with type arguments of type Reference
ReferentialIntegrityException(Map<Location,List<Reference>> invalidReferences)
           
ReferentialIntegrityException(Map<Location,List<Reference>> invalidReferences, String message)
           
ReferentialIntegrityException(Map<Location,List<Reference>> invalidReferences, String message, Throwable cause)
           
ReferentialIntegrityException(Map<Location,List<Reference>> invalidReferences, Throwable cause)
           
 

Uses of Reference in org.jboss.dna.graph.property.basic
 

Classes in org.jboss.dna.graph.property.basic that implement Reference
 class UuidReference
          A Reference implementation that uses a single UUID as the pointer.
 

Methods in org.jboss.dna.graph.property.basic that return Reference
 Reference UuidReferenceValueFactory.create(BigDecimal value)
          Create a value from a decimal.
 Reference UuidReferenceValueFactory.create(Binary value)
          Create a value from the binary content given by the supplied stream.
 Reference UuidReferenceValueFactory.create(boolean value)
          Create a boolean from a string.
 Reference UuidReferenceValueFactory.create(byte[] value)
          Create a value from the binary content given by the supplied array.
 Reference UuidReferenceValueFactory.create(Calendar value)
          Create a value from a Calendar instance.
 Reference UuidReferenceValueFactory.create(Date value)
          Create a value from a date.
 Reference UuidReferenceValueFactory.create(DateTime value)
          Create a value from a date-time instant.
 Reference UuidReferenceValueFactory.create(double value)
          Create a value from a double.
 Reference UuidReferenceValueFactory.create(float value)
          Create a value from a float.
 Reference UuidReferenceValueFactory.create(InputStream stream, long approximateLength)
          Create a value from the binary content given by the supplied stream.
 Reference UuidReferenceValueFactory.create(int value)
          Create a value from an integer.
 Reference UuidReferenceValueFactory.create(long value)
          Create a long from a string.
 Reference UuidReferenceValueFactory.create(Name value)
          Create a value from a name.
 Reference UuidReferenceValueFactory.create(Path value)
          Create a value from a path.
 Reference UuidReferenceValueFactory.create(Reader reader, long approximateLength)
          Create a value from a the binary content given by the supplied reader.
 Reference UuidReferenceValueFactory.create(Reference value)
          Create a value from a reference.
 Reference UuidReferenceValueFactory.create(String value)
          Create a value from a string, using no decoding.
 Reference UuidReferenceValueFactory.create(String value, TextDecoder decoder)
          Create a value from a string, using the supplied decoder.
 Reference UuidReferenceValueFactory.create(URI value)
          Create a value from a URI.
 Reference UuidReferenceValueFactory.create(UUID value)
          Create a value from a UUID.
 

Methods in org.jboss.dna.graph.property.basic that return types with arguments of type Reference
 ValueFactory<Reference> StandardValueFactories.getReferenceFactory()
          Get the value factory for reference properties.
 ValueFactory<Reference> DelegatingValueFactories.getReferenceFactory()
           
 

Methods in org.jboss.dna.graph.property.basic with parameters of type Reference
 int UuidReference.compareTo(Reference that)
          
 UUID UuidValueFactory.create(Reference value)
          Create a value from a reference.
 Reference UuidReferenceValueFactory.create(Reference value)
          Create a value from a reference.
 URI UriValueFactory.create(Reference value)
          Create a value from a reference.
 String StringValueFactory.create(Reference value)
          Create a value from a reference.
 Path PathValueFactory.create(Reference value)
          Create a value from a reference.
 Object ObjectValueFactory.create(Reference value)
          Create a value from a reference.
 Name NameValueFactory.create(Reference value)
          Create a value from a reference.
 Long LongValueFactory.create(Reference value)
          Create a value from a reference.
 DateTime JodaDateTimeValueFactory.create(Reference value)
          Create a value from a reference.
 Double DoubleValueFactory.create(Reference value)
          Create a value from a reference.
 BigDecimal DecimalValueFactory.create(Reference value)
          Create a value from a reference.
 Boolean BooleanValueFactory.create(Reference value)
          Create a value from a reference.
 Binary AbstractBinaryValueFactory.create(Reference value)
          Create a value from a reference.
 T[] AbstractValueFactory.create(Reference[] values)
          Create an array of values from an array of references.
 



Copyright © 2008-2009 JBoss, a division of Red Hat. All Rights Reserved.